Thank you very much for the info respecting cstm. Yes, a shutdown and restart
is on the schedule for this weekend.

cstm>ssd
 followed by
cstm>ssu
 seems to have cleared things up.  The stalled SYSCONFJ completed shortly
thereafter.

> We run a version of the SYSCONF job, last update in 2006 from the comments,
> on the first of every month.  I am a little late this month because of other
> more pressing issues.  How that may be, I evntually got around to streaming
> it yesterday and I find that it is still running:
>
> #J825   EXEC        10S LP       TUE  8:52A  SYSCONFJ,MANAGER.SYS
>
> Looking at STDOUT I see this:
>
>  :echo****************************************************** > *list  :#
> **************************************************
>  :# * This step is for gathering NMMGR config info   *
>  :# **************************************************
>  :echo > *list
>  :file nmmgrcmd=$stdinx
>  :RUN NMMGR.PUB.SYS > *list
>  :echo > *list
>  :echo > *list
>  :echo****************************************************** > *list
>  :echo*            OUTPUT FROM MEMMAP & IOMAP              * > *list
>  :echo****************************************************** > *list  :echo
>> *list  :if hpversion > "C.60.00"
>  *** EXPRESSION TRUE
>  :  echo map   > temp
>  :  echo exit >> temp
>  :  echo      >> temp
>  :  XEQ CSTM.PUB.SYS < temp > *list
>
>
> When I run this from the command line I see the problem but do not know what
> to do to fix it:
>
> :xeq cstm.pub.sys
> CSTM B8343AA.75.05  Version created TUE, MAR 23, 2004  8:24 AM Running
> Command File (/usr/sbin/stm/ui/config/.stmrc).
>
>
> This operation may take approximately one minute.
>
> Waiting to obtain host information from the local host
> hahp3k01.harte-lyne.ca.
> The diagnostic daemon "diagmond" may have been started recently and is busy
> building the device map.
>
>
> If this message persists for a long time, it is possible that either the
> diagnostic daemon is not running, or that networking is improperly
> configured.
> The networking configuration can be verified by comparing 'nslookup
> `hostname`'
> with the output of ifconfig of the LANs identified by lanscan.
>
>
> If you cancel this message, the User Interface (UI) will not automatically
> connect to a Unit Under Test (UUT).  It will be necessary to use the Select
> Current System command in the System menu to attach the UI to a UUT.
>
> I can find neither lanscan nor nslookup on the HP3000.
>
>
> The only sysadmin things done on the HP3000 since the last run of SYSCONFJ
> had to do with changing the network mask from 255.255.255.0 to
> 255.255.255.128, using nmmgr, and rearranging the network printers.
>
> I need some advice as to how to fix this.
